Red River Bancshares (NASDAQ:RRBI – Get Free Report) pos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day. The company reported $1.78 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.76 by $0.02, Zacks reports. The company had revenue of $33.70 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$33.66 million. Red River Bancshares had a net margin of 26.25% and a return on equity of 12.65%.

About Red River Bancshares
Red River Bancshares, Inc is a bank holding company headquartered in Alexandria, Louisiana, operating through its principal subsidiary, Red River Bank. Established in 1998, the company provides a full range of commercial banking services designed to meet the needs of individuals, small to mid-size businesses, and nonprofit organizations. Red River Bank has built its reputation on personalized customer service and a commitment to supporting economic growth within its service area.
The company’s core offerings include commercial and industrial lending, real estate financing, consumer and residential mortgage loans, and deposit products such as checking, savings, money market accounts and certificates of deposit.
